and means on the flange means and on said wall means for slidable interengagement to retain the cover against lifting away from said wall means, upward sliding removal of the cover being diicult and thereby discouraging surreptitious opening of the cover by a would-be pilferer while the container is hanging from a suspension device.
5. A hang-up display device as defined in claim 4, in which the cover has interlock means thereon coactive with the upper portion of the w-all means to resist upward sliding movement of the cover relative to the container, and the upper tab having clearance opening for said interlock means.

IN A DISPLAY ASSEMBLY, A HANG-UP SUPPORTING CARD, SAID CARD HAVING AN APERTURE THERETHROUGH RECEPTIVE OF A MERCHANDISE CONTAINER, SAID CARD HAVING PROJECTING INTEGRALLY IN ONE PIECE THEREFROM MATERIAL STRUCK FROM SAID APERTURE AND COMPRISING A PAIR OF ALIGNED TABS EACH OF WHICH HAS A TAB PORTION IN A PLANE WITH THE OPPOSITE TAB AND AN ANGULAR CONNECTING FLANGE JOINING IT TO THE CARD, A CONTAINER HAVING A BOTTOM WALL AND A PERIPHERAL WALL RECEIVED IN SAID APERTURE WITH THE BOTTOM WALL PROJECTING FROM THE FACE OF THE CARD OPPOSITE SAID TABS AND WITH THE EDGE OF SAID PERIPHERAL WALL OF THE CONTAINER ENGAGING SAID TABS, SAID PERIPHERAL WALL AT THE OPEN END OF THE CONTAINER HAVING MEANS THEREON INTERENGAGEABLE WITH A SLIDEON COVER, A SLIDE-ON COVER ENGAGING SAID MEANS AND CLOSING THE CONTAINER AND CLAMPING SAID TABS AGAINST SAID PERIPHERAL WALL, AND INTERLOCK MEANS ON SAID COVER ENGAGEABLE WITH SAID PERIPHERAL WALL TO RESIST REMOVAL OF THE COVER, ONE OF SAID TABS HAVING AN APERTURE THEREIN FOR CLEARING SAID INTERLOCK MEANS AND INTERLOCKINGLY COACTING WITH SAID INTERLOCK MEANS.
